Off-Broadway's hilariously irreverent musical comedy; A Musical About Star Wars, which was forced to close in 2020, is excited to announce they are returning for a strictly-limited two week engagement at The American Theatre of Actors. With performances beginning Friday, Dec 17th the musical comedy celebrates the blockbuster film franchise, nerd culture, cosplay, and comic-con in a show-within-a-show that is a little meta and hella rad.

Since 1978, West Bank Cafe has been one of the epicenters of New York City’s theatre community, and due to the pandemic, it is on the verge of permanently closing. With Broadway dark, tourism down, indoor dining closed, and no relief plan in sight, 2020 has created a plethora of financial problems for the beloved theater district institution.
